Robot Innovations That Changed the World

World-changing robotic innovations have created a significant impact in various sectors. From manufacturing to healthcare, the application of robotic technology has brought greater efficiency and profound transformation to society. One innovation that is worth emulating is collaborative robots or cobots. In contrast to traditional robots that usually work separately from humans, cobots are designed to work side by side with workers. This increases productivity in the production process, allowing humans and machines to complement each other. In the automotive industry, for example, cobots are used in vehicle assembly, providing greater accuracy and speed. The healthcare sector is also experiencing major changes thanks to robots. Surgical robots, such as the Da Vinci Surgical System, allow doctors to perform operations with extraordinary precision via remote control. This technology reduces patient recovery time and post-operative complications, creating better outcomes. Additionally, nursing robots can aid in patient monitoring in hospitals, providing more consistent care. In the agricultural realm, robotic technology is also an innovator. Drones and agricultural robots are used to monitor plant health and carry out automatic watering or fertilization. This reduces resource use and increases crop yields. Innovations in agricultural produce collecting robots enable farmers to work more efficiently, reducing labor and time costs. In the logistics sector, mobile robots are key in increasing the efficiency of storing and delivering goods. An example is the goods-moving robots used in Amazon warehouses, which increase the speed of order processing. These robots automate the product picking and moving process, reducing human workload and minimizing errors. The entertainment industry is also being affected by robotics. Humanoid robots such as Honda’s ASIMO and Hanson Robotics’ Sophia demonstrate advances in human-machine interaction. These two robots can not only walk and talk, but also interact socially, paving the way for the application of robots in various aspects of daily life, such as education and customer service.
